The nucleolus is a condensed region of chromatin where ribosome … WebThe mechanism of ATP synthesis appears to be as follows. During the transfer of hydrogen atoms from FMNH 2 or FADH 2 to oxygen, protons (H + ions) are pumped across the crista from the inside of the mitochondrion to the outside. Thus, respiration generates an electrical potential (and in mitochondria a small pH gradient) across the membrane ...
